Spectrum 2 is one of the newest cases in CS:GO. It was added to the game on September 14th, 2017, alongside the «China Are you Ready?» update. The Spectrum 2 case contains 17 kinds of knife and weapon skins, including the top AWP skin, as well as the improved PP-Bizon Judgment of Anubis rifle and UMP-9 pistol. The case has a popular rating of 99%..

Chroma 3 was released April 27th 2016 alongside the «Trichromacy Update». It includes weapons from the community. It requires the Chroma 3 Case Key to open.
